Answer:
Step-by-step explanation:
y=mx+b where m is the slope and b is the y intercept. Since there is point (0,0) we know that b=0 so we only need to find m
m=(y2-y1)/(x2-x1)
m=(4-0)/(2-0)=4/2=2 so the line is
y=2x
